Cost Components of Data Analytics Software
Understanding the full investment is crucial for accurate ROI calculation:
- Subscription licensing: Monthly or annual fees based on user count, viewer/interactor tiers, and feature levels.
- Implementation and setup: Initial configuration, data source connections, security setup, and initial dashboard/report development.
- Training and onboarding: Educating users on platform functionality, best practices for visualization, and self-service capabilities.
- Infrastructure costs: For on-premise or hybrid deployments (servers, storage, licensing for underlying databases).
- Integration costs: Connecting to data warehouses, ETL tools, CRM systems, and other business applications.
- Add-ons and extensions: Additional functionality for advanced analytics, forecasting, data preparation, or specialized industry templates.
- Support and maintenance: Access to customer support, updates, technical assistance, and training resources.
- Hidden costs: Data preparation overhead, license inefficiency (unused viewers), time spent on manual workarounds, and costs for overcoming platform limitations.
Software Overview: Tableau vs Power BI vs Looker
Tableau
Best for: Organizations prioritizing powerful, interactive visualizations, deep analytical capabilities, and strong community support.
Strengths:
- Industry-leading visualization capabilities with drag-and-drop ease for creating complex, interactive dashboards.
- Strong data connectivity with native connectors to hundreds of data sources and databases.
- Excellent performance with large datasets through Hyper engine and data extract capabilities.
- Vibrant community with Tableau Public, extensive forums, and abundant third-party resources.
- Flexible deployment options: cloud (Tableau Online), on-premise (Tableau Server), or hybrid.
Considerations:
- Per-user licensing can become expensive at scale, especially for enterprise-wide deployment.
- While powerful, the platform can have a steeper learning curve for advanced calculations and dashboard development.
- Data management and preparation features, while improving, may require additional tools like Tableau Prep for complex ETL.
- Some users report that administrative overhead for server maintenance and scaling can be significant.
Microsoft Power BI
Best for: Organizations already invested in the Microsoft ecosystem seeking tight integration with Excel, Azure, and Office 365.
Strengths:
- Seamless integration with Microsoft 365 (Excel, Teams, SharePoint), Azure services, and Dynamics 365.
- Unified self-service and enterprise BI platform with Pro and Premium tiers.
- Strong data modeling capabilities with DAX language and flexible data shaping in Power Query.
- Affordable entry point with Power BI Pro at a low monthly cost per user.
- Regular monthly updates with new features and improvements.
Considerations:
- While improving, some users find visualization capabilities less flexible or aesthetically limited compared to Tableau.
- Premium capacity pricing can be complex and expensive for large-scale deployments with many users.
- Reliance on Microsoft ecosystem may limit appeal for organizations heavily invested in non-Microsoft stacks.
- While powerful for reporting, advanced data science and machine learning integration may require additional Azure services.
Google Looker
Best for: Organizations prioritizing data modeling consistency, embedded analytics, and strong integration with Google Cloud Platform.
Strengths:
- Unique modeling layer (LookML) ensures consistent business logic and metrics across all users and reports.
- Strong embedded analytics capabilities for integrating data applications directly into SaaS platforms and internal tools.
- Excellent scalability and performance with cloud-native architecture on Google Cloud infrastructure.
- Strong data governance features with centralized control over data access and definitions.
- Seamless integration with BigQuery, BigQuery ML, and other Google Cloud data analytics services.
Considerations:
- While Looker Studio (formerly Data Studio) is free, the Looker platform (now part of Looker Studio Pro and Looker API) is a paid offering focused on embedded and enterprise use cases.
- Learning LookML requires investment in training for data modeling teams.
- While strong for data exploration and embedded use cases, some users find ad-hoc visualization less intuitive than Tableau.
- Dependency on Google Cloud Platform may limit appeal for multi-cloud or on-premise-heavy organizations.
Data Analytics Software Cost Breakdown (Typical 3-Year TCO)
| Cost Category |
Percentage of Total |
Notes |
| Subscription Licensing |
45-55% |
Monthly/annual fees based on user count, viewer/interactor tiers, and feature levels |
| Implementation and Setup |
15-25% |
Data source connections, security setup, initial development, and user provisioning |
| Training and Onboarding |
10-20% |
Role-based training, self-service enablement, and adoption programs |
| Infrastructure (if applicable) |
0-10% |
Servers, storage (on-premise); minimal for cloud-only |
| Integration and Add-ons |
5-15% |
Data warehouse, ETL, CRM, and other business system connections |
| Support and Hidden Costs |
5-15% |
Technical assistance, data preparation overhead, license inefficiency, and workaround expenses |

Hidden Cost Mitigation Strategies
To maximize data analytics ROI, organizations should proactively address these common hidden costs:
- Data preparation overhead: Invest in proper data modeling and ETL processes to reduce time spent cleaning and shaping data for analysis.
- License inefficiency: Regularly audit user roles and adjust licenses (viewer vs. explorer vs. creator) based on actual usage.
- Underutilization: Track dashboard and report usage to identify and retire unused content.
- Over-reliance on IT: Empower business users with self-service capabilities while maintaining governance.
- Workaround costs: Invest in training to utilize platform features fully and reduce reliance on manual exports or spreadsheets.
- Performance tuning: Optimize data models, extracts, and queries to ensure fast response times for interactive dashboards.
Use Case Recommendations
Choose Tableau if:
- You prioritize best-in-class visualization and interactive dashboards for data storytelling.
- Your organization values a strong user community and extensive third-party resources for learning and extension.
- You need flexible deployment options (cloud, on-premise, or hybrid) to match your IT strategy.
- You are willing to invest in higher per-user costs for superior analytical flexibility and performance.
Choose Power BI if:
- You are already invested in the Microsoft ecosystem and want seamless integration with Excel, Teams, and Azure.
- You value a low-cost entry point (Power BI Pro) and the potential to scale with Premium capacity.
- You need strong data modeling and DAX capabilities for complex calculations and business logic.
- You appreciate regular updates and a unified self-service/enterprise BI platform.
Choose Looker if:
- You prioritize data modeling consistency and governed metrics through a centralized LookML layer.
- You want strong embedded analytics capabilities to integrate data applications directly into your products or internal tools.
- You are heavily invested in Google Cloud Platform and want seamless integration with BigQuery and related services.
- You value strong data governance and centralized control over data definitions and access.
